I recently got a mouse, it's great, feels great, but one problem.
Moving the middle mouse button side-to-side acts as a forward/back button. I hate it and definitely not something I would like to have.
Is there a way to re-assign the side-to-side mouse wheel buttons (to make them side scroll instead), or completely disable them?

EDIT: SOLVED!
SOLUTION: Downloaded an application called SetPoint from the Logitech website, and was a dream. It's basically a control panel for your mouse, allowing you to change any setting imaginable (the software detects the mouse youre using). Works pretty similar to a NvIDIA Control Panel, but with more options...and it's for the mouse. Works great and solved problem with ease
